Exploring the Potential of Managed Document Review in Legal Services

Jul 29, 2023

Managed document review is a crucial process in the legal industry that involves reviewing and analyzing large volumes of documents during the discovery phase of a legal case. In recent years, the potential of managed document review has significantly expanded, primarily due to advancements in technology and the growing need to handle massive amounts of electronic data. Here are some key aspects that highlight the potential of managed document review in legal services:

Efficiency and Cost-Effectiveness:

Traditional manual document review can be time-consuming and costly, especially when dealing with extensive data sets. Managed document review leverages technology like e-discovery software, artificial intelligence, and machine learning to accelerate the process. It helps legal professionals review documents more efficiently, reducing the time and resources required for the review, ultimately leading to cost savings.

Scalability:

In modern legal cases, the volume of electronic documents can be overwhelming. Managed document review can easily scale to handle large data sets, which would be impractical or impossible to manage manually. This scalability is essential in complex litigation and investigations.

Consistency and Quality:

Automated review processes can maintain a higher level of consistency and accuracy than manual review, where human reviewers may face fatigue or overlook important details. Advanced AI algorithms can also learn from human expert decisions, improving their accuracy over time.

Risk Mitigation:

Managed document review can help identify potential risks and sensitive information early in the discovery process. By flagging privileged, confidential, or sensitive data, legal teams can avoid potential issues related to inadvertent disclosure.

Predictive Coding and Technology-Assisted Review (TAR):

These technologies use machine learning algorithms to prioritize and classify documents based on relevance. This approach helps legal teams quickly identify and focus on the most important documents, reducing the time and effort required for manual review.

Global Collaboration:

Managed document review can facilitate collaboration among legal teams spread across different locations. Cloud-based e-discovery platforms allow seamless access to documents and case-related information, promoting collaboration and communication.

Data Security and Compliance:

With the increasing concern for data security and privacy, managed document review providers ensure robust data security measures. Compliance with relevant regulations such as GDPR (General Data Protection Regulation) and CCPA (California Consumer Privacy Act) is essential when handling sensitive data during the review process.

Flexibility in Review Teams:

Managed document review allows legal firms to build review teams that are specific to each case’s requirements. Attorneys with expertise in particular areas can be assigned to review documents most relevant to their knowledge, increasing the accuracy and speed of the review.

Focus on Strategy and Case Development:

By leveraging technology for document review, legal professionals can allocate more time to strategizing and building stronger legal cases, which can be critical to their clients’ success.

Despite the many advantages, it’s important to note that managed document review is not a one-size-fits-all solution. Some cases may still require a higher level of human review and analysis, especially when dealing with nuanced legal matters. The successful implementation of managed document review requires a balance between technology and human expertise, with legal professionals providing oversight and ensuring the process meets the necessary legal standards.

In conclusion, managed document review offers tremendous potential for legal services, enabling faster, more efficient, and cost-effective document analysis. As technology continues to advance, the role of managed document review is likely to become even more integral to the legal industry, streamlining processes and enhancing the overall quality of legal services provided to clients.
